“Thank you to those who helped her get back up,” said M.me Collard, who nevertheless deplores the lack of security in the Montreal metro.

“No security guard in sight in this huge station,” she decried.

In response to an Internet user who advised avoiding the metro at the end of the evening, the columnist replied: “That’s the problem. I love my metro. I don’t want it to become a stopgap for those who have no choice. I want it to be safe so that we can use it safely at all times.”

For his part, columnist Richard Martineau learned of his daughter’s savage attack during a break from his show on Qub radio.

“Insecurity in the metro has become a personal matter,” he commented on the air.

In 2023, 600 violent events were reported in the Montreal metro, compared to 742 the previous year.
